Project Description: General Notice
Cumberland County (Owner) is requesting Bids for the construction of the following Project:
C-21 & Y-1 Preservation Contract
Bids for the construction of the Project will received online via PennBID until Tuesday, December 23, 2025, at 12:00 PM local time. At that time the Bids received will be publicly opened and read.
The Project includes the following Work:
For Bridge C-21 the work generally includes the removal of the asphalt wearing course, placement of a waterproof membrane, repaving the wearing course and general bridge maintenance. For Bridge Y-1 the work generally includes the milling and hydrodemolition of the existing deck wearing surface, applying a latex modified concrete overlay and general bridge maintenance.
Bids are requested for the following Contract: C-21 & Y-1 Preservation Contract

Statutory Requirements.
Bidders must comply with all State antibid-rigging regulations pertaining to work associated with this project, and will be required to submit an executed non-collusion affidavit with the bid.
Bidders should refer to provisions of federal and state statutes, rules and regulations dealing with the prevention of environmental pollution and preservation of public natural resources that affect the project, pursuant to Act No. 247 of the General Assembly of the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ania, approved October 26, 1972.
This Project falls under The Commonwealth of Pennsylvania enacted Act 127 of 2012, known as the Public Works Employment Verification Act (‘the Act’) which requires all public work contractors and subcontractors to utilize the Federal Government’s E-Verify system to ensure that all employees performing work on public work projects are authorized to work in the United States. All Bidders are required to submit a Public Works Employment Verification Form as a precondition for the Contract Award.
The estimated cost for this project is greater than Twenty-five Thousand Dollars ($25,000) and the Pennsylvania Prevailing Wage Act shall apply.
All bids shall be irrevocable for 60 days after the bid opening date as provided by the Act of November 26, 1978 (P.L. 1309, No. 317), as amended by the Act of December 12, 1994 (P.L. 1042, No. 142).
All bidders are hereby notified that in regard to any contract pursuant to this advertisement, businesses will be afforded full opportunity to submit bids in response to this notice and will not be subjected to discrimination on the basis of gender, race, color, creed, sex, age, physical disability or national origin in consideration for an award. Similarly the successful bidder shall in no manner discriminate against or intimidate any employee involved in the manufacture of supplies, the performance of work, or any other activity required under the contract on account of gender, race, creed or color.
Cumberland County reserves the right to waive any defects, errors, omissions, mistakes, informalities, to accept any bid or combination of bids that are deemed to be in the best interest of Cumberland County, and to reject any or all proposals.
